Understanding the Basics of Hybrid Cloud Technology
The hybrid cloud model allows organizations to leverage both public and private cloud services, enabling them to optimize their IT strategies effectively. By combining these environments, businesses can declare improved data security and compliance while accessing the flexibility needed for various workloads. For instance, organizations can choose to run sensitive applications on a private cloud and scale less critical workloads through IBM Cloud’s public services, ensuring both performance and security are maintained.
Incorporating desktop virtualization within a hybrid cloud setup offers companies a means to provide secure and scalable access to applications and data from any device. This approach not only enhances user experience but also facilitates remote work capabilities, which are increasingly essential in today’s business landscape. By utilizing a hybrid cloud model, organizations can efficiently manage resources and reduce costs while maintaining the flexibility to adapt to changing market demands.

The Role of on-Premises Infrastructure
The integration of on-premises infrastructure plays a crucial role in the functionality of hybrid cloud systems. Businesses utilize this setup to maintain their backup strategies and ensure that critical data remains secure and quickly accessible. By employing virtual machines in conjunction with on-premises systems, organizations can achieve high availability while optimizing their resource management within the cloud environment.
This blend also supports the practices of DevOps, providing a seamless connection between development and operations. By keeping sensitive workloads on-site, companies can mitigate risks associated with data breaches, while still taking advantage of cloud scalability for less critical applications. This dynamic approach not only enhances operational efficiency but also aligns with the organization’s overall IT goals.

Complexity in Management
Complexity in management remains a significant challenge for organizations adopting hybrid cloud architecture. This complexity often stems from the need to integrate various cloud management tools and platforms, such as Microsoft Azure Stack, into their existing IT framework. Effective orchestration of workloads across public and private environments requires a sophisticated understanding of both cloud infrastructures and the associated software as a service (SaaS) applications. Without proper oversight, organizations may struggle to optimize resource allocation, leading to inefficient operations and increased costs.
Furthermore, the dynamic nature of hybrid environments complicates governance and compliance efforts. Businesses must ensure that their cloud management strategies align with regulatory standards while maintaining visibility over their data flows. Failing to establish clear protocols can leave organizations vulnerable to security breaches and compliance issues, highlighting the need for robust management solutions that facilitate seamless monitoring and control. By addressing these complexities, companies can harness the full potential of hybrid cloud solutions and improve their operational efficiency.
Potential Compliance and Security Risks
The integration of hybrid cloud solutions introduces potential compliance and security risks that organizations must address to safeguard their data. As businesses leverage a mix of on-premises data centers and public cloud services, managing data across these environments can complicate compliance with regulations such as GDPR. Without a well-structured governance strategy, companies may encounter challenges in data provisioning and application software management, jeopardizing not only their operational productivity but also their reputation.
Organizations face heightened security risks when adopting hybrid cloud architectures, particularly with sensitive data stored off-site. This challenge necessitates vigilant risk management practices, including the implementation of robust encryption and access controls. To mitigate these risks, companies can employ comprehensive monitoring tools that ensure visibility across both private and public environments, ultimately fostering a productive and secure cloud deployment that bolsters business resilience.
